表单发送回服务器,两种情况:(1)每当点击ASP.NET的Web网页上的Button、 LinkButton或ImageButton等控件时,表单就会被发送到服务器上

                                                (2)如果某些控件的AutoPostBack属性被设置为true,那么当该控件的状态被改变后,也会使表单会发送回服务器 如dropdownlist

postback:每次当表单被发送回服务器,就会被重新加载,启动Page_Load事件,执行Page_Load事件处理程序中的所有代码(注意,是每次都会执行!)。

autopostback:它只有两个bool值,true/false。如果这个属性被设置成false,那么点击后就不会立刻将变化传给服务器处理,也就不会有该控件的SelectedIndexChanged事件

IsPostBack:在网页第一次加载时,该属性的值是false。如果网页因回送而被重新加载,IsPostBack属性的值就会被设置为true。

     当我们希望只有在网页第一次加载时执行另一些代码(基本上都是数据的默认绑定),甚至希望一些代码在除首次加载外的每次加载时执行。那么我们可以利用 IsPostBack特性来完成   这 一   功能。在网页第一次加载时,该属性的值是false。如果网页因回送而被重新加载,IsPostBack属性的值就会被设置为true。

相关文章:

  • 2021-11-30
  • 2021-06-26
  • 2021-06-28
  • 2021-12-25
  • 2021-04-05
  • 2021-07-19
  • 2021-08-31
  • 2021-06-05
猜你喜欢
  • 2021-05-31
  • 2021-06-20
  • 2021-07-03
  • 2021-08-09
  • 2022-12-23
  • 2022-12-23
  • 2021-11-02
相关资源
相似解决方案